East Yorkshire has typical unpredictable British weather. So here are some ideas to keep everybody
happy when the weather is not the most ideal.
William's Den, North Cave
The outdoor and indoor areas are suitable for children of all ages to have fun. There are nests to
explore, rope bridges to cross, a tree-house and a slide. The attached Kitchen provides fresh food made
from locally sourced ingredients serving a selection of treats.
East Riding Leisure Centres
Known for a fun learner pool alongside an incredible fun zone with two slides as well, it is perfect
for kids to find their feet in the water, have fun and explore. Its 6 climbing walls offer a different
challenge on each. This place is suitable for anyone over the age of 4 and you can refuel at cafe with
fresh food, snacks and cakes.
Sewerby Hall and Gardens
When the weather’s not sure, take cover in the Hall and learn how life was in the early 1900s for
the residents and workers of the house. Then explore the zoo and meet the pigs, parrots and penguins!
Kids of all ages are welcome.
Withernsea Lighthouse
There’s no limitation to the age of kids to climb Withernsea Lighthouse, which is 144 steps to the
top, with full views of the East Yorkshire Coast at the top of it. Enjoy the museum on the ground floor
and learn what life is like working and living in a lighthouse. The souvenir shop provides attractive gifts
for visitors at a fair price.

With 19:40 on the clock in the first half of the University of Vermont’s match-up against Albany in
March, Josh Speidel caught a pass and scored. The crowd went wild, and the coaches and players of both
teams hugged Josh. Josh announced, “I did it! I’m a college basketball player!”
Making a single lay-up (单手上篮) would be no big deal for the average player. But five years ago,
Josh suffered a brain injury in a car accident only months after signing with the UVM Catamounts. Josh
had offers from 15 universities, but playing for UVM had always been his dream.
After the accident, he went into a coma (昏迷) and the doctors told his parents that he might remain
in a vegetative state or need round the-clock care for the rest of his life. But his parents never lost faith
that their son would wake up, and agreed they wouldn’t tell Josh his terrible prognosis when he did.
Four weeks later
,
Josh proved them right. Not only did he learn to walk and talk again, soon he was
even working out. But the goal of playing basketball was a driving force in Josh’s recovery.
Just a year and a half after the accident, he headed off to Burlington, Vermont to start college. With
periodic arm tremors and short-term memory loss, Josh knew he would never play for UVM, but he
watched every practice from the sideline and became an important part of the team. UVMs associate
head coach Kyle Cieplicki, who’d been Josh’s lead recruiter, said, “He’s shown the whole team how to
handle adversity.”
Now 24, Josh will graduate from UVM in May with a 3.4 GPA. He’s majoring in education and
social services, and plans to work with kids. Josh tells people who are struggling with their own
challenges,” Always have a goal in your head and chase after it as hard as you can. And whenever you
need help, ask.”
